What We’re Looking For
We’re looking for a student completing their BSC Architectural Technology degree or equivalent or a student completing their HNC/HND in Construction, Architecture or Architectural Technology to join our team on a paid work experience placement.
This placement will provide hands on experience working alongside our professional team on live projects, giving you exposure to the full architectural process from technical delivery to client liaison.
What You’ll Be Doing:
Assisting in the preparation of drawings, specifications, and schedules
Supporting site surveys and records of existing buildings
Undertaking administrative tasks related to project documentation
Learning to ensure compliance with building regulations, health & safety, and quality procedures
Collaborating with colleagues on projects to meet client requirements and deadlines
Responding to client queries and supporting the wider team with technical tasks
